Paradise Exhumed by Ian Thompson.

REVIEWED BY Tina Shobe 


Paradise Exhumed (Ray Hammett Thrillers 1)Paradise Exhumed by Ian Thompson
My rating: 5 of 5 stars

If you like intense murder mysteries this book is for you!

Seasoned reporter Ray Hammett and newbie Jessica Summers are sent on assignment to interview an old adversary of Ray's. They arrive at her house and discover a gruesome murder. This turns their investigation into a murder mystery. Through their investigation they meet and interview several suspects.

The author does a really good job of describing the characters with their individual quirks and each of the scenes. I felt that I was right there with Ray and Jessica as each scene unfolded.

As the story goes along it seems to get more and more intense. The murders are gruesome and unsettling. I really liked that the author had a way of pulling me into the book that I was attempting to solve the mystery too. Every person I thought was the killer ended up being killed. It had me constantly changing my thought process.

It was becoming a race against Ray and Jessica discovering the killer before they became the killed.

This book is very intense and very well written. It had me guessing right till the very end!
